BNI Announces the First Round's Winners of the Rejeki Wondr Lucky Draw

PT Bank Negara Indonesia (Persero) Tbk, or BNI, announced the first round’s winners of the BNI Wondr Lucky draw program on August 11, 2025, at Grha BNI, Jakarta. This loyalty program, running from April 2025 to the end of January 2026, offers thousands of spectacular prizes, including luxury cars, motorcycles, and electronic devices.

BNI Consumer Banking Director Corina Leyla Karnalies explained that BNI Rejeki Wondr is BNI's way of showing appreciation to loyal customers. The prizes prepared include two units Mercedes-Benz New E300, 14 units Chery J6, 20 units Honda HR-V, 170 units Honda Beat, hundreds of smartphones, and various other exciting prizes.

"This program is open to all BNI customers. Lucky draw coupons can be obtained automatically thru banking activities such as opening an account, increasing savings balance, and financial transactions in the wondr by BNI application," said Corina in her written statement.

The BNI Wondr Rejeki lucky drawing will be held in two stages, namely in August 2025 and February 2026. Interestingly, the prizes were distributed down to the branch level to increase the chances of customers across Indonesia.

In addition to Corina, the first round of the drawing was also attended by BNI Director Rian Eriana Kaslan, Network and Sales SEVP Sri Indira, Wealth Management SEVP Steven Suryana, as well as representatives from the Ministry of Social Affairs, the DKI Jakarta Provincial Government, and notaries. Hundreds of winners have been announced and prizes will be sent to each winner soon.

"Congratulations to the winners who have been set out. We hope that thru this program, we can continue to strengthen customer loyalty and provide the best service," said Corina.

BNI encourages customers to continue increasing their balances and increasing transactions on wondr by BNI to increase their chances of winning in the second round drawing, which will take place in February 2026.

On the same occasion, Corina also urged the public to be more vigilant against fraud schemes that use the name of BNI's Rejeki Wondr program. She emphasized that BNI never charges any fees for the prize claiming process.

"If anyone asks for money claiming a prize, it's definitely a scam," she said.

Corina added that official information regarding BNI's lucky draw program is only communicated thru BNI's official communication channels. For information on the program's winner list, customers can visit BNI's official website at bni.id/rejekiwondrbni or access the wondr by BNI application.
